Xcode 如何为WKInterfaceGroup设置小于2点的固定高度或宽度?

Xcode 如何为WKInterfaceGroup设置小于2点的固定高度或宽度?,xcode,watchkit,Xcode,Watchkit,当我将Watch序列图像板中的界面对象的高度或宽度设置为1点时,在我取消选择后,它会恢复为2,然后再次选择该对象。Xcode 6.3.2就是这样 下面是我如何设置高度的示例: 取消选择后,再次选择对象: 但是我真的想要一个1点(2像素)的高度,手表应该能够显示这个高度 我正在使用WKInterfaceGroup创建一个1点高分隔符。问题与2.0以下的任何数字相同(例如,0.5或1.5也会恢复为2.0),因此Xcode storyboard editor似乎不接受这些参数小于2.0的值。我在W

当我将Watch序列图像板中的界面对象的高度或宽度设置为1点时,在我取消选择后,它会恢复为2,然后再次选择该对象。Xcode 6.3.2就是这样

下面是我如何设置高度的示例:

取消选择后,再次选择对象:

但是我真的想要一个1点(2像素)的高度,手表应该能够显示这个高度


我正在使用WKInterfaceGroup创建一个1点高分隔符。问题与2.0以下的任何数字相同(例如,0.5或1.5也会恢复为2.0),因此Xcode storyboard editor似乎不接受这些参数小于2.0的值。我在WKInterfaceImage中发现了同样的问题。

我找到了一个简单的解决方案,即在代码中设置高度。这有点麻烦,因为这意味着我需要在控制器代码
@界面中为组设置一个出口:

@property (nonatomic, weak) IBOutlet WKInterfaceGroup *separatorGroup;
当然,故事板中也应该设置插座

然后在刷新代码中,我简单地设置高度或宽度,如下所示:

    [self.separatorGroup setHeight:1.0];